site stats

Hash map in data structure

WebJan 25, 2024 · A hash table, also known as a hash map, is a data structure that maps keys to values. It is one part of a technique called hashing, … WebAug 18, 2024 · HashMap is a dictionary data structure provided by java. It’s a Map-based collection class that is used to store data in Key & Value pairs. ... But the main point of hash map is to access the ...

Java HashMap internal Implementation by Anmol Sehgal

WebDec 12, 2024 · Understanding HashMap Data Structure(Ruby) In this article I will be talking about another data structure HashMap, so let’s start by understanding what a data … WebSep 14, 2015 · We will go through a basic Hash Map implementation in C++ that is supporting generic type key-value pairs with the help of templates. It is genuinely not a production-ready implementation of HashMap class, however it simply shows how this data structure can be implemented in C++. Below, HashNode class represents each bucket … suzzanne douglas net worth 2021 https://ofnfoods.com

Hash Table/Hash Map Data Structure Interview Cake

WebThe ‘Hash Map’ Data Structure. Feb 19 2024. Computers read data from memory by its address — and memory addresses are numbers — so arrays are a natural data structure for sequence types which support ‘getting’ values by their numeric index. When we ‘get’ from an array, the computer can use the index to calculate the memory ... WebHash Maps c++17 containers intermediate. Related: Hash Sets Hash maps, sometimes called dictionary or table, are known as unordered maps in C++. The C++ standard … Web1 day ago · Expert Answer. You will implement the constructor, as well as the hash, Insert, and search methods for an unordered set data structure that stores strings. The set will use open addressing with linear probing to resolve collisions. Provided is a template that you must follow: The set must satisfy the following requirements: - hash-based (not ... skechers slip on shoes for men hands free

CSCI-1200 Data Structures — Spring 2024 Lecture 23

Category:Basics of Hash Tables Tutorials & Notes Data …

Tags:Hash map in data structure

Hash map in data structure

Complex Data Structures: Hash Maps Cheatsheet Codecademy

WebMar 21, 2024 · Hashing is a technique or process of mapping keys, and values into the hash table by using a hash function. It is done for faster access to elements. The efficiency of mapping depends on the efficiency of the hash function used. Let a hash function H (x) … Data Structure & Algorithm Classes (Live) System Design (Live) DevOps(Live) … A Graph is a non-linear data structure consisting of vertices and edges. The … Data Structure & Algorithm Classes (Live) System Design (Live) DevOps(Live) … Design a data structure that supports insert, delete, search and getRandom in … Time Complexity: O(n), as we traverse the input array only once. Auxiliary Space: … The linked list data structure is used to implement this technique. So what …

Hash map in data structure

Did you know?

Webdefabc (100 1 + 101 2 + 102 3 + 97 4 + 98 5 + 99 6)%2069 11. Hash table. A hash table is a data structure that is used to store keys/value pairs. It uses a hash function to compute an index into an array in which an … WebJan 25, 2024 · A hash table, also known as a hash map, is a data structure that maps keys to values. It is one part of a technique called hashing, the other of which is a hash function. A hash function is an …

WebPrestaShop/paypal is an open source module for the PrestaShop web commerce ecosystem which provides paypal payment support. A SQL injection vulnerability found in the PrestaShop paypal module from release from 3.12.0 to and including 3.16.3 allow a remote attacker to gain privileges, modify data, and potentially affect system availability. WebIn computing, a hash table, also known as hash map, is a data structure that implements an associative array or dictionary. It is an abstract data type that maps keys to values . [2] A hash table uses a hash function to …

WebAug 7, 2010 · Map inverted = map.keySet ().stream ().collect (Collectors.toMap ( s -> map.get ( s ), s -> s ) ); Create a hashmap that maps Object to Object - then you can use the same map to store String -> Integer and Integer -> String. When you add a string/int pair just add it both ways to the same map. Web해시: 색인 또는 인덱스; hash function: key->hash로 만들어 주는 함수; 해시테이블: hash를 주소로 삼아 데이터를 저장하는 자료구조

WebHash maps are a common data structure used to store key-value pairs for efficient retrieval. A value stored in a hash map is retrieved using the key under which it was …

WebAll links need to be rehashed in this function after resizing Args: capacity: the new number of buckets. """ # create a temporary hashMap with the given capacity temp = HashMap(capacity, self._hash_function) # iterate over the buckets in the existing hash table, calculate index for each key for the temporary hashMap # and put the key and … skechers slip on shoes for men wideWebJul 14, 2024 · A HashMap (or a HashTable) is a data structure that allows quick access to data using key-value pairs. The Java HashMap class extends the AbstractMap class and implements the Map interface, which gives it access to a lot of operations. HashMaps have two type parameters—K and V, where K stores the keys and V stores the values in each … skechers slip on shoes mens 9.5WebJava HashMap class implements the Map interface which allows us to store key and value pair, where keys should be unique. If you try to insert the duplicate key, it will replace the element of the corresponding key. It is easy to perform operations using the key index like updation, deletion, etc. HashMap class is found in the java.util package. skechers slip on shoes menWebWhile reading about different data structures, found that the Emblem table used by compilers are classified as an data structure. Can someone explain what will the difference between Symbol table d... suzzanne douglas the cosby showWebHash maps are a common data structure used to store key-value pairs for efficient retrieval. A value stored in a hash map is retrieved using the key under which it was … skechers slip on shoes size 16WebNov 6, 2024 · To learn more about the HashMap, visit this article: HashMap in Java. HashMap in Java works on hashing principles. It is a data structure which allows us to store object and retrieve it in ... suzzanne douglas cause of death cancerWebHash map is a widely used efficient data structure that used to store data which can be searched in constant time O (1). It is also referred as hash table, unordered map, … skechers slip-on shoes for women